NYC Alliance has acquired 525 America for an undisclosed sum.
525 America, which was founded by husband and wife Bobby and Marianne Bock almost 30 years ago, is known for its women’s contemporary sweaters. The brand will now be led by Lynn Siemers-Shea, the chief executive officer of NYC Alliance, a privately held company that designs, manufactures and distributes women’s clothing.
“This is an exciting acquisition for NYC Alliance, and in line with our strategic objectives to diversify our portfolio,” said Siemers-Shea, who added that she will work with Bobby and Marianne Bock going forward. “We will continue to look for strategic partnerships with companies that are design-centric and that have strong management teams.”
“525 America has always been about the product and the customer’s relationship to it. I am confident that this new phase for the brand will continue in that vein,” said Robert.
525 America is currently sold at retailers including Revolve, Shopbop and Bloomingdale’s.
